The Petitioner has approached this Court with the following prayers: "a) Direct the Respondent No. 5 to decide the visa Application dated 25.01.2024 preferred by the Petitioner;

b) Direct the Respondents to grant the Petitioner tourist visa / regular visa OR IN THE ALTERNATIVE grant her tourist visa / regular visa subject to imposing a fine/penalty upon the Petitioner;

c) Direct the Respondents to provide the Petitioner valid reasons in case of rejection of her visa application;

d) Pass any other Order, direction that this Hon‟ble Court deems fit and proper qua the facts and circumstances of the present Case in the best interest of justice."

communication addressed to him by the Joint Deputy Director, BOI Hqrs, East Block-VIII, R. K. Puram, New Delhi-66. The said communication reads as under:

"Subject: Writ Petition titled Aurelie Lafittee Vs. Union of India and Ors. in the Hon'ble High Court of Delhi.

The present application is filed by Aurelie Lafittee d/o Jean Pierre Lafittee in regards to her Visa Application.

2. It is intimated that a grade „D‟ BL exists against Aurelie Lafittee (French National), at the behest of FRRO Mumbai dated 27.07.2023 for „staying on tourist visa for a period of more than 18 months‟ with retention date 26.07.2023.

3. The above mentioned input/comment of BOI can be used in preparing the affidavit.

4. This is for kind information and filing reply before the Court."

3.

It is stated by the learned Counsel for the Respondents that in view of the aforesaid communication, it is apparent that the Petitioner will get tourist visa as and when she applies after 26.07.2024. The statement is taken on record.

4.

The writ petition is disposed of, along with pending application(s), if any.
